// For DSPF on an input port the elmore delay is used as the time
// constant of an exponential waveform. The delay to the logic
// threshold and slew are computed for the exponential waveform.
// Note that this uses the driver thresholds and relies on
// thresholdAdjust to convert the delay and slew to the load's thresholds.
void
RCDelayCalc::dspfWireDelaySlew(const Pin *,
float elmore,
ArcDelay &wire_delay,
Slew &load_slew)
{
float vth = .5;
float vl = .2;
float vh = .8;
float slew_derate = 1.0;
if (drvr_library_) {
vth = drvr_library_->inputThreshold(drvr_tr_);
vl = drvr_library_->slewLowerThreshold(drvr_tr_);
vh = drvr_library_->slewUpperThreshold(drvr_tr_);
slew_derate = drvr_library_->slewDerateFromLibrary();
}
wire_delay = static_cast<float>(-elmore * log(1.0 - vth));
load_slew = (drvr_slew_ + elmore * log((1.0 - vl) / (1.0 - vh))
/ slew_derate) * multi_drvr_slew_factor_;
}
